What users praise
- • Unified scikit-learn-like API across forecasting, classification, regression, and clustering.
- • Rich composable pipelines and ensembles for complex model building.
- • Active community with regular updates and innovative features like Craft().
What frustrates them
- • Over 2,300 open GitHub issues suggests maintenance strain.
- • Documentation for advanced features can be sparse.
- • Lacks native categorical feature support for classification/forecasting.

How hard is Sktime to learn?
Users describe it as intermediate · typically A few hours to get going
Where people get stuck
- • Understanding composite model building
- • Navigating high number of open issues
- • Lack of categorical support requires data preprocessing
Who Sktime actually suits
Works well for
- • Data scientists prototyping time series models
- • Researchers needing a unified framework for multiple tasks
- • Developers building custom pipelines and ensembles
Not the right fit for
- • Production-critical applications requiring high reliability
- • Users needing native categorical feature support
- • Teams that require extensive documentation and support
